Contemporary Indian culture is a study in duality. In a single day, a young professional in Delhi might wear a business suit to a corporate office, use a UPI payment app on their smartphone, and then remove their shoes to touch the feet of an elder at home. The rise of global pop culture has merged with local roots, creating "Indie-pop" music and fusion fashion (sarees with sneakers). Diwali, the festival of lights, is a psychological reset button, where homes are scrubbed clean, new clothes are donned, and the darkness is literally pushed back by millions of oil lamps. Holi, the festival of colors, serves as a great social equalizer—when doused in colored powder, caste, class, and age distinctions temporarily dissolve.
